Understanding KYC (Know Your Customer) Procedures
As part of their commitment to security and regulatory compliance, online casinos typically implement KYC (Know Your Customer) procedures. These procedures require players to verify their identity by submitting documentation such as a copy of their passport, driver's license, or utility bill. The purpose of KYC is to prevent fraud, money laundering, and underage gambling. While some players may find the KYC process inconvenient, it's a standard practice in the industry and a crucial step in ensuring a safe and secure gaming environment. Completing the KYC process promptly can also expedite withdrawals, as platforms are required to verify the identity of players before processing large payouts.
The specific documentation required for KYC verification may vary depending on the platform and the player's location. However, typically, players will need to provide proof of identity, proof of address, and potentially proof of ownership of their payment methods. It's important to submit clear and legible copies of the required documents to avoid delays in the verification process. Reputable platforms will handle personal information with utmost confidentiality and in accordance with data protection regulations. Recognizing the Signs of Problem Gambling
Being aware of the warning signs of problem gambling is crucial, both for yourself and for others. These signs can include spending increasing amounts of time and money on gambling; chasing losses; lying to others about gambling habits; neglecting personal responsibilities; and experiencing emotional distress as a result of gambling. If you or someone you know is exhibiting these behaviors, it's important to seek help. Numerous organizations offer support and resources for problem gamblers, including the National Council on Problem Gambling and Gamblers Anonymous. Early intervention is key to preventing problem gambling from escalating and causing significant harm.
